Goal Battle is a real-time PvP soccer simulation game for mobile, featuring squad building and fast-paced online matches.

Velocity

Maintenance developmentperformanceopaqueShow more...

The app currently ships at a cadence of approximately 0.2 releases per week, placing it in the maintenance tier. Development activity is limited to minor bug fixes and performance improvements, with no evidence of new features or live-ops content in the observed data. The publisher is currently maintaining stability rather than driving active feature development or seasonal engagement.

The Analyst's Read

Key takeaways for Goal Battle - Soccer Games

Where is it heading?

The casual soccer market is shifting toward higher-fidelity simulations and social-heavy experiences, leaving Goal Battle exposed to churn. Unless the team addresses the ad-monetization friction and technical lag, the current decline in chart rank will likely continue through the next quarter.

  • Aggressive ad frequency post-update disrupts the core loop, which accelerates churn among casual players who previously sustained the #78 Grossing rank.
  • Technical instability and lag during matches degrade the experience, which compounds the negative sentiment already visible in the latest user reviews.
